取代bash,macOS Catalina使用zsh作为默认Shell

- 编辑:admin -

取代bash,macOS Catalina使用zsh作为默认Shell

尽管苹果已经得到基于 GPLv2 许可协议的 bash 3.2 版本, 固然很多 Mac 开发者已经开始使用像 Fish 这样的越发现代化的 shell,请尽快在 bash 被彻底裁减之前,适应全新的终端设置。

macOS Catalina 另有一个重大的变革 —— zsh 已代替 bash 成为新版操纵系统中的默认 shell ,bash 并不会当即从 macOS Catalina 中消失。

假如你有意转投 macOS Mojave 时引入的 zsh,因为像苹果这样自签发的企业。

但苹果暗示用户应该开始转向使用 zsh,pdf转换器,www.xper.cn,zsh 拥有越发灵活的自动完成特性, 在昨天的 WWDC 大会上,但新版的 bash 回收了 GPLv3 协议,但 zsh 和 Bourne shell(sh)与大大都 bash 越发兼容,苹果隆重介绍了 macOS 的下一个重大版本 Catalina ,。

会在代码审核和看待许可证的态度上越发严格,在 macOS Catalina 中所有新建设的用户帐号都将使用 zsh,且个中包括了明确的专利授权,虽然,因为 bash 最后可能照旧会被移除, 不外对付开发者和高级用户来说, ▲ bash on macOS Mojave 默认环境下。

苹果没有解释做出这一决定的原因,但揣摩与 GPLv3 开源协议有关,以尽快习惯这一变革,www.aepnet.com,为了辅佐用户顺利过渡, 苹果一直没有在 macOS 中使用 GPLv3 软件包, 酷毙 雷人 鲜花 鸡蛋 。